Having conducted many investigations into information manipulation campaigns, we know that they do not operate isolated. The same state actors that conduct cyber espionage also orchestrate disinformation campaigns; we demonstrated it multiple times in our research into the Pravda network, or else the GRU’s Information Operations Troops. Infrastructure overlaps (shared hosting, coordinated domain registration, bot networks) make it impossible to analyze one threat without the other.
Defenders need a single operational platform that bridges Cyber Threat Intelligence (CTI) and FIMI analysis, and they need structured, actionable data to feed it. Enter OpenCTI: developed by Filigran, it is the only open-source threat intelligence platform purpose-built to handle both CTI and FIMI workflows. VIGINUM’s April 2025 doctrine explicitly recommends OpenCTI as the platform for capitalizing on information threat knowledge, using STIX 2.1 as the common language.
The CheckFirst Import Connector provides access to the CheckFirst Pravda Network Feed, a complete database of over 7 million articles published by the Pravda network since its inception. New articles from the network are detected and ingested every day, ensuring your knowledge base stays current. Each article’s structure follows state-of-the-art recommendations for identifying, modeling, storing and enriching threat knowledge. The connector offers a ready-to-deploy external import connector that handles API authentication, pagination, state persistence and batch ingestion automatically.
